Public will have to pay for daily tests for Covid-19

Dido Harding, the Government’s testing czar, has suggested that the daily “moonshot” tests for Covid-19 which will allow people to resume normal life will not be available on the NHS. Instead she has said that individuals and companies would have to pay to access the proposed tests, which would return results in as little as 15 minutes, as a “cost of doing business”.

Up to 10 million of the tests are due to be made available every day as a way of getting the UK closer to normality before the advent of a coronavirus vaccine. If you take the test and get a negative result it means you are not contagious – even if you are infected – and can therefore visit the theatre, attend a conference or socialise without fear of passing on Covid-19 that day.
